23 Configuring Server Load
Balancing
Alcatel-Lucent’s Server Load Balancing (SLB) software provides a method to logically manage a group of
physical servers sharing the same content (known as a
server farm
) as one large virtual server (known as
an
SLB cluster
). SLB clusters are identified and accessed using either a Virtual IP (VIP) address or a QoS
policy condition. Traffic is always routed to VIP clusters and either bridged or routed to policy condition
clusters. The OmniSwitch operates at wire speed to process client requests and then forward them to the
physical servers within the cluster.
Using SLB clusters can provide cost savings (costly hardware upgrades can be delayed or avoided),
scalability (as the demands on your server farm grow you can add additional physical servers), reliability
(if one physical server goes down the remaining servers can handle the remaining workload), and
flexibility (you can tailor workload requirements individually to servers within a cluster).
